$200,000 ANNUAL WHITE SLAVE PRICE.
We have said there are 2,000 White Slaves sold every year.
The average price is $100 a girl, according to a well known federal
official, who has investigated and prosecuted several hundred cases of
White Slavery.
That makes the aggregate purchase price of White Slaves in Chicago
annually, $200,000!
This same official declared that the South side levee district contributes
$60,000 a year to the White Slave Trust for new victims.
The balance is paid by the resort keepers of the other districts of vice
and by keepers of the "houses of call"--the places where men of wealth and
bestial perversion seek for virgins on whom to wreak the fury of abandoned
passions!

THE SHACKLES OF THE WHITE SLAVE.
Many a girl after a month of horror, revolts against the conditions
confronting her; the terrors in her dreams of the future fill her soul
with fear and she yearns for freedom once again.
The dreams, which the stories told her by the procurer aroused, have never
materialized; she is as poor as she was before she was trapped into the
life of shame; she is broken in spirit and in health.
Can she walk out a free woman?
No. She is a White Slave; the slavery is not just one of selling and
purchasing; it is one of permanent bondage in ninety cases out of one
hundred.
The man who trapped her has become her "cadet." He is her "guardian" for
her master. His word is law. She is a slave forever. She is treated
brutally if she makes serious attempts at escape; she is even locked in a
room and in some instances women have been tied hands and feet to
bedposts.
She is at times drugged in order to make her forget her misery and her
plans of escape. Every possible precaution is taken to prevent her release
from bondage.
